Must Read: How to Convert Marketing Qualified Leads to Sales Qualified Leads This is where understanding Marketing Qualified Lead helps you Marketing Qualified Lead is a visitor on your web page who has shown repeated interest in your website content (not necessarily your product or services) and is likely to become your customer. For example, they have downloaded an e-book in exchange of their contact details and now they are browsing through the product you offer in the area.While this may sound simple, it points towards the problem the visitor might be facing (a pain point of sorts!) which your content may be able to solve. A Marketing Qualified Lead may or may not be ready to convert into a paying customer. Such visitors have to be nurtured constantly to help them determine that your product is the solution to their needs. Once they see your product as a possible solution to their problems, they have moved a step further in the sales funnel. A Marketing Qualified Lead (or MQL) gets converted into Sales Qualified Lead (or SQL) when the sales team identify that visitor as \u20ac\u0153ready to buy\u20ac\u009d your product or services because they have shown interest and fit your \u20ac\u0153buyer\u20ac\u009d profile. This can be identified by the behavior of the MQL. For example, they have indicated that they want you to call them and give information about the product. Must Read: MQL to SQL conversion rate That gets us to our next question, MQL vs. SQL? &nbsp;The basic difference between Marketing Qualified Lead and Sales Qualified Lead (MQL vs SQL) is that an MQL is a visitor who is aware of their problem and SQL is the lead who knows that your product may be the solution to their problem. In other words, the intention and readiness to buy your product differentiate them.&nbsp;An MQL may not be ready to buy your product today but a SQL is a lead which can be approached by your sales team immediately. SQL desires very specific details and incentives to convert into a customer which can be in terms of discounts, free trials or any other type of promotional offer. What are the key benefits of implementing Marketing Qualified Lead System? A Better understanding of the requirements of your ideal client&nbsp;&#8211; when you are tracking the behavior of the visitor on your web page, you are aware of their needs. Your marketing teams can then channelize their efforts into converting them to a Sales Qualified Lead and handing them over to sales. Improves ROI of content marketing&nbsp;&#8211; Marketing Qualified Leads lets the marketer know who exactly they need to target with their content. Result is the improved ROI from content marketing. Improves revenue&nbsp;&#8211; If the efforts of your team is focused on MQLs\/SQLs and not on that freelancer who is passer-by, it will definitely result in improved revenues. A more effective Sales Funnel&nbsp;&#8211; Your marketing team nurtures the leads in a way where they are now \u20ac\u0153solution aware\u20ac\u009d and want to weigh options available in the market including yours. It is now that your sales team can effectively provide them with incentives they requires to convert. Reduces wastage&nbsp;&#8211; A more targeted approach to nurturing Marketing Qualified Leads helps to reduce the wasted efforts of your teams behind visitors who never convert. Better alignment between marketing and sales team&nbsp;&#8211; When there is a formal criterion defining Marketing Qualified Leads and Sales Qualified Leads (i.e. the lead score metrics), there is less space for confusion between marketing and sales team. According to the \u20ac\u0153A sales and marketing love story\u20ac\u009d from&nbsp;HubSpot 94% of the sales people feel that marketing hands them over questionable prospects 40% marketers do not even know what MQL or an SQL is 59% of marketers do not have an agreement with sales on who will be considered an SQL or MQL.
